中国移动的数据库技术解析
中国移动使用的数据库是Oracle数据库。
中国移动是中国最大的移动通信运营商之一,拥有庞大的客户群体和海量的通信数据。为了管理和存储这些数据,中国移动选择了Oracle数据库作为其主要的数据库管理系统。
Oracle数据库是一种关系型数据库管理系统,具有强大的数据管理和处理能力。它支持高并发性、高可靠性和高扩展性,能够满足中国移动大规模的数据存储和处理需求。
Oracle数据库还提供了丰富的功能和工具,包括数据备份和恢复、数据安全性管理、性能优化等,能够帮助中国移动有效地管理和维护其数据资产。
Oracle数据库还具有灵活的扩展性,可以根据中国移动的业务需求进行扩展和定制。它支持分布式数据库架构,可以将数据分布在多个服务器上,以实现高可用性和负载均衡。
最后,中国移动选择Oracle数据库还有一个重要原因是Oracle在数据库领域的领先地位和广泛应用。作为全球最大的数据库供应商之一,Oracle数据库得到了全球范围内众多企业和组织的认可和信赖。选择Oracle数据库可以为中国移动提供更好的技术支持和服务保障。
中国移动选择使用Oracle数据库是基于其强大的数据管理和处理能力、丰富的功能和工具、灵活的扩展性以及Oracle在数据库领域的领先地位。通过使用Oracle数据库,中国移动能够高效地管理和处理海量的通信数据,提供优质的服务和用户体验。
中国移动使用的数据库是Oracle数据库。
中国移动使用的主要数据库是Oracle数据库。Oracle数据库是一种关系型数据库管理系统,具有高性能、高可用性和可扩展性。它是全球最流行的企业级数据库之一,被广泛应用于各个行业的大型企业和机构。
下面将从方法、操作流程等方面对中国移动使用的Oracle数据库进行详细讲解。
-
数据库安装与配置
中国移动需要在服务器上安装Oracle数据库软件。安装过程中需要选择合适的版本和组件,根据服务器的硬件配置和需求进行配置。安装完成后,需要进行数据库的初始化和配置,包括设置系统参数、创建数据库实例、配置监听器等。 -
数据库创建和管理
中国移动在Oracle数据库中可以创建多个数据库实例,每个数据库实例可以包含多个表空间和用户。在数据库中创建表空间和用户可以使用SQL语句或者Oracle管理工具,如SQL*Plus、SQL Developer等。创建表空间时需要指定表空间的名称、数据文件的位置和大小等参数;创建用户时需要指定用户名、密码、默认表空间等信息。 -
数据库备份与恢复
数据库备份是保证数据安全和可恢复性的重要措施。中国移动可以使用Oracle提供的备份工具,如RMAN(Recovery Manager)进行数据库备份。备份可以包括全量备份和增量备份,全量备份是将整个数据库备份到磁盘或磁带中,而增量备份是只备份发生改变的数据。备份完成后,还需要进行备份验证和恢复测试,以确保备份的完整性和可用性。 -
数据库性能优化
为了提高数据库的性能,中国移动可以采取一系列的优化措施。首先是通过监控和调整数据库参数,如SGA(System Global Area)和PGA(Program Global Area)的大小,以及各种缓冲区的大小。其次是优化SQL语句,如使用合适的索引、优化查询语句、避免全表扫描等。还可以通过分区、分表等方式进行数据管理和查询优化。 -
数据库安全与权限管理
数据库安全是保护数据免受未经授权的访问和修改的重要任务。中国移动可以通过设置用户权限和角色、使用数据库加密、启用审计等方式增强数据库的安全性。还可以定期进行安全漏洞扫描和补丁升级,及时修复数据库中的安全问题。
总结:
中国移动使用的主要数据库是Oracle数据库。在使用Oracle数据库时,需要进行数据库安装与配置、数据库创建和管理、数据库备份与恢复、数据库性能优化以及数据库安全与权限管理等工作。通过合理的配置和管理,中国移动可以确保数据库的稳定性、安全性和性能。